✦ Synopsis
Let F 7 denote the Fano matroid and e be a fixed element of F 7 . Let P(F 7 , e) be the family of matroids obtained by taking the parallel connection of one or more copies of F 7 about e. Let M be a simple binary matroid such that every cocircuit of M has size at least d 3. We show that if M does not have an F 7 -minor, M{F 7 *, and d (r(M)+1)Â2 then M has a circuit of size r(M)+1. We also show that if M is connected, e # E(M), M does not have both an F 7 -minor and an F 7 *-minor, and M Â P(F 7 , e), then M has a circuit that contains e and has size at least d+1.
